动态笔尖加载自动布局

时间:2015-09-02 12:09:48

标签: ios autolayout xib

我正在将没有自动布局的笔尖更新为具有自动布局的笔尖。

今天笔尖基本上包含两个视图:

1 /顶部的视图使用以下命令从笔尖动态加载:

[[NSBundle mainBundle] loadNibNamed:nibName owner:self options:nil] 

笔尖可以有不同的高度。

2 /底部的视图使用剩余空间。

所以我不太清楚如何干净利落地做到这一点。我愿意以编码方式做任何事情来获得最清晰,最简单的方法来解决这个问题。

非常感谢你的帮助!

1 个答案:

答案 0 :(得分:0)

在代码中,您需要添加约束以固定到刚刚从NIB加载到初始帧大小值的视图的大小。然后将其添加为故事板中存在的任何容器视图的子视图,并将视图的边缘固定到其新的超视图。

在故事板中,将容器视图固定到其周围的视图中。